Jacqueline and Alex ~ A Elegant and Romantic Wedding at the Crane Estate in Ipswich, MA

Jacqueline and Alex we married at the Crane Estate in Ipswich, MA. This fun loving couple first me back in 2014 in Baton Rouge, Louisiana when Jacqueline was getting her PhD and Alex, a cinematographer, came to town to shoot a movie. After their first date, Alex was smitten and Jacqueline already knew, she had just met the man she would marry. When the film wrapped and Alex headed back to LA the two stayed in touch, maintaining a long distance relationship. About a year later, Jacqueline was packing up her bags and heading to up to California to join Alex.

We started the day with our bride getting ready at a private home and the groom with his men at the Inn at Castle Hill. Upon entering the home where the bride, her family and her friends we getting ready it was all warmth and sparkle. The home, located on a small farm, had horses lounging in the sun outside and inside the farm house the ladies were dressed in jewel toned gowns and Jacqueline was making last minute adjustment to her personal vows. Alex and the men, looking handsome in their navy suits, gathered outside on the porch of the Inn. With the help of his best man, Alex put on his finishing touches including a gorgeous peacock feather bow tie. After slipping into her gown and gloves, Jacqueline was ready for her first look with Alex back at the Estate.

Under the rustic cloister on the Crane Estate property, Alex waited to get his first look at Jacqueline. The couple chose this venue for tis timeless beauty and because it also reflected their love of the outdoors. The sun was shining and the sky was perfectly blue as our bride approached our groom. After some sweet moments together, the two took their positions as guests arrived. For Alex, the first look was one of the favorite parts of the day. Jacqueline admitted to having fun peeking out from behind the rock wall to get a glimpse of guests arriving!

As the sun slowly crept lower, the ceremony began. Alex and Jacquline made their personal vows, exchanged rings and finally became husband and wife. After departing under crossed swords, it was on to the reception!

In the Barn at the Crane Estate, Alex and Jacqueline created an earthy, eclectic and fun oasis for their family and friends. Upon entering, guests first saw wedding photos of generation past spread across the welcome table and a backdrop set up for candid photos and fun! Surrounded by loved ones, the two were treated to heartfelt toasts and then danced the night away!
